Don't use Miracle Grow Moisture Control Potting soil on your hosta.

I repotted a bunch of hosta yesterday. My oldest hosta, an unknown blue variety was one I knew needed it desperately. I had moved it up to a larger pot last year as it had well over 100 eyes. Unfortunately, I used Miracle Grow Moisture Control Potting soil.

Steve mentored me on potting soil in the spring, so I went back and replaced the soil in several I worked on early last year. This pot was so large, I put off doing it, thinking it's so big and has survived everything, so, it will be ok...Wrong.

When I knocked out the soil ball, it had turned to heavy clay. It was just heavy black mud. It now has only about 40 eyes. There aren't many roots. I'm sure it will be fine, although a lot smaller than before the Miracle Grow.
